Dark Brotherhood mod *spoilers*
Are there any mods out there that allow you to hunt and kill the DB? Sort of like in Skyrim where if you didn't want to join them you had the option of hunting them down, even if it was just a short little quest. As a good character I hate having this quest to join them stuck in my log permanently.

Thanks for any tips.

There are a number of people that count as "Murders" in the game even if they assault you first or are a required target to finish a quest. The first that comes to mind is the last true round of the Arena to become Grand Champion, that counts as murder, and it's not the only one. I've got about seven counts of murder on my current character and I've never used this one to commit a single crime, haven't even picked up a spare cheese wheel. The system is just finnicky sometimes about certain characters, or just certain situations, flagging as murder.

And yes, I know you can kill Lucien but as the game itself then tells you, you lose any way to find the Dark Brotherhood from that point on. Miomazi Mar 2, 2015 @ 5:58pm 
Originally posted by Goldenkitten:
The first that comes to mind is the last true round of the Arena to become Grand Champion, that counts as murder, and it's not the only one.
Would just like to state, that unless there's a glitch that I've never experienced, this only counts as a murder if you've finished the quest Origins of the Gray Prince, and inform him of his bloodline.
